The Allure of Beachfront Venues: A Double-Edged Sword

High Costs Without High Returns

Beachfront venues often come with a premium price tag. Expect to pay between $250 to $400 per person per night just for lodging. This doesn’t include food, activities, or transportation, which can quickly inflate your budget. In contrast, inland venues may offer similar amenities at a fraction of the cost.

Distractions Galore

While the beach might seem like a perfect backdrop for team-building activities, the reality is that the sound of waves and the allure of sunbathing can lead to disengagement. Teams may find it challenging to focus on important discussions when they can hear the ocean calling.

Limited Availability and Flexibility

Many popular beachfront venues book up quickly, especially during peak seasons. This can limit your options and force you to book far in advance. If you’re looking for flexibility in your planning, opting for non-beachfront venues can provide more availability and potentially better rates.
